Overview

This PR adds the "Supported by Posit" badge to the infer website.

Background

We've recently started adding a "Supported by Posit" badge across all Posit package websites to create a more cohesive brand presence. The badge appears on the far right of the top navigation bar or at the bottom of the hamburger menu. It links to Posit’s main website. @hadley is involved with this initiative.

The following websites already have the "Supported by Posit" badge: ggplot2, Great Tables, gt, Plotnine, Pointblank, pointblank, and Quarto.

See https://posit-dev.github.io/supported-by-posit/ for more information.

Changes

  • Added a line to _pkgdown.yml to include the JavaScript file
  • Standardized indentation in _pkgdown.yml
